Ronald McDonald Houses of Central Florida Receive $21,000 in Appliance Donations

August 12, 2021 by Natalia Jaramillo

The Ronald McDonald House Charities of Central Florida (RMHCCF) are receiving $21,000 in appliance donations from Conn’s HomePlus philanthropic sector called Conn’s Cares.  The three locations across Central Florida, which include the Lake Nona Ronald McDonald House near Nemours Children’s Hospital, received six washer and dryer pairs, three stoves, three dishwashers, … [Read more...]

Library Board Votes to Work With the City and County on Branches in Lake Nona Area and Horizon West

August 9, 2021 by Ashley Cisneros Mejia, M.S.

Local residents are closer than ever to having a public library in the Lake Nona area. On Thursday, July 8, the Orange County Library System (OCLS) Board of Trustees voted unanimously “to direct staff to pursue working with Orange County and the City of Orlando for libraries at both locations: Horizon West and Lake Nona.” The board took this action after hearing a joint … [Read more...]
